The station is equipped with basic amenities to ensure a smooth journey. For ticket-buying conveniences, the ticket office is open on weekdays from 06:30 to 11:00, and there are ticket machines available for easy collection of pre-purchased tickets. Accessibility features include step-free access—although limited and requiring specific navigation routes—accessible ticket machines, and customer help points strategically placed around the station.
Shepherds Well station offers assistance for travelers with reduced mobility, with staff help available during restricted hours. While the station is not equipped with an induction loop or ticket barriers, it does include a help point for navigating the platform. However, for more significant needs outside operating hours, Southeastern provides a mobile Assistance Team to aid travelers with their specific requirements.

The station provides essential facilities for travelers, ensuring a comfortable journey. The ticket office operates from early morning until early afternoon on Saturdays, though it remains closed during weekdays and Sundays. However, you can still purchase tickets or collect pre-purchased tickets from the accessible ticket machines located on-site. It's worth noting that smartcards are supported at the station, aligning with modern, streamlined travel conveniences.
For those with specific accessibility needs, Alderley Edge station offers partial step-free access and is categorized as a scooter-friendly location, making it navigable for those using mobility aids. There's no waiting room available, yet the station ensures passenger security with the presence of CCTV. Unfortunately, facilities such as restrooms, baby changing rooms, and refreshment outlets are not provided, so plan accordingly.
Beyond the station itself, Alderley Edge is well-connected through various transport links. Although direct bicycle hire services aren't available, the station provides limited bicycle storage facilities for those traveling with bikes. For taxi services, visitors can arrange their rides using online platforms such as Cab4You. Bus services are also in operation with convenient stops nearby, allowing for easy intermodal transfer.
